The story of Sunfab is a remarkable Swedish saga, a 100-year journey of family, ingenuity, and transformation that began in 1925 with its founder, Eric Sundin. It is a tale that started in an unexpected place: what was once the world's largest ski factory. From this origin, a new and powerful legacy was born.

    At the very heart of this story is a moment of brilliant innovation. Eric Sundin, a true visionary, ingeniously adapted the technology he was using for ski production to create something entirely new. From this creative spark, Sunfab's technologically advanced hydraulic pumps and motors—and even the very first mobile lifting crane—all originated. It is a story of a company that has, from its very beginning, been characterized by innovation, skill, and a vision for the future.

    Today, after a full century, the company is proudly guided by the third generation of the Sundin family, who continue to run the business in the same spirit as their grandfather. From their state-of-the-art factory in Hudiksvall, all development and manufacturing remains proudly "Made in Sweden," a commitment that has allowed them to become one of the world's leading companies in hydraulics. This local manufacturing excellence is supported by a powerful global presence, which includes their own subsidiaries in the USA, Europe, and a strategic hub for Southeast Asia in Malaysia. After 100 years, the story of Sunfab is one of a family company that has successfully taken its unique legacy of innovation to the world.
